I am trying to print client 1065 return and worksheets. I am able to print to a PDF but cannot print to printer.

                                                                                         'xxx.tmp'

The message is, "Adobe Acrobat Reader could not open 'C282.tmp' because it is either not a supported file type or because the file has been damaged....."

Has anyone else had this issue? Both ProSeries and Windows 10 updates have been installed, my workstation has been rebooted.

I did speak with support.

They blame the printer driver for Adobe. However, Adobe has been updated and I have no issues printing to a PDF and then printing the PDF.. I can even open the *.tmp files that ProSeris prints to and print them, the same files ProSeries identifies and not valid.
